iguess and wps - chirs eykamp
DESCRIPTION
COST Action TU0902 Meeting: Web Processing Service (WPS) technologies for Integrated Assessment Modelling in Urban AreasTRANSCRIPT
![Page 1: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/1.jpg)
Chris Eykamp, Luís de Sousa, Christian Braun,Ulrich Leopold, Olivier Baume, Rui Martins
How I Learned to StopWorrying and Love WPS
![Page 2: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/2.jpg)
MUSIC: European project to help cities reduce their CO2 emissions related to energy
Partnership of 5 European cities and 2 research centers (funded by INTERREG IV B NWE)
iGUESS is a modeling platform and decision support system
What is iGUESS?
![Page 3: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/3.jpg)
Searching for a way to run models
![Page 4: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/4.jpg)
Interoperability between partners Simplify access to complex data/tools Create reusable framework Distributable codebase
Conclusion: Design iGUESS around OWS
iGUESS Design GoalsSolution: Open Web Services
(OWS)
![Page 5: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/5.jpg)
WPSWPS
WPSWPS
WPSWPS
WMS WFS WCS
WMS WFS WCS
WMS WFS WCS
WPSiGUESS
Model Servers Data Servers
Solar Potential
Wind Potential
Emissions
Partner City
EU Agency
Research Org.
WMS WFS WCS
Results Servers
Schematic View
![Page 6: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/6.jpg)
![Page 7: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/7.jpg)
![Page 8: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/8.jpg)
![Page 9: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/9.jpg)
![Page 10: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/10.jpg)
![Page 11: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/11.jpg)
![Page 12: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/12.jpg)
![Page 13: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/13.jpg)
![Page 14: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/14.jpg)
![Page 15: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/15.jpg)
What couldbe better?
![Page 16: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/16.jpg)
[1] Get all metadata in a single request
![Page 17: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/17.jpg)
XML JSON
[2] Communicate in XML and JSON
![Page 18: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/18.jpg)
[3] MUST DESTROY running processes
![Page 19: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/19.jpg)
[4] Let WPS make callbacks
![Page 20: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/20.jpg)
[5] Better specification of inputs and outputs
![Page 21: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/21.jpg)
?? What about security ??
![Page 22: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/22.jpg)
Chris Eykamp, Luís de Sousa, Christian Braun,Ulrich Leopold, Olivier Baume, Rui Martins
How I Learned to StopWorrying and Love WPS
![Page 23: iGUESS and WPS - Chirs Eykamp](https://reader033.vdocuments.net/reader033/viewer/2022060120/559188741a28abcd4c8b46dd/html5/thumbnails/23.jpg)